Born in 1977 in Virginia, Plaxico Burress is known for his career as a free agent wide receiver in the National Football League. Burress attended Michigan State University where he set a Big Ten Conference single-season record for catching passes (65) in his very first season there. He was named to the All-Big Ten Conference twice before he was drafted by the Pittsburgh Steelers in the first round of the 2000 NFL draft. Burress played with the Steelers until 2004, after which point he joined the New York Giants. It was while he was with the Giants that he was selected to the All-Pro (2007) and won a Super Bowl championship ring (XLII). After the 2008 season, Burress became a free agent in the NFL due to some unsavory legal troubles.
